Truist analyst Ki Bin Kim raised the firm’s price target on Prologis to $140 from $135 and keeps a Buy rating on the shares. While higher national new supply, a soft economic backdrop and a weaker market rent growth may pose risks, the firm continues to see upside surprises for Prologis. Truist recommends focusing on AFFO growth compared to FFO growth on a go forward basis.
